Greenhouse gas emissions by sector in Japan
Japan: Greenhouse gas emissions by sector was 22.77 million tonnes in 2023. ▼ Falling
Greenhouse gas emissions by sector in Japan, 1990–2023
Source: Climate Watch (2026) –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in tonnes.
Analysis
Japan recorded 22.77 million tonnes for greenhouse gas emissions by sector in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 34 years on record.
The figure is down 0.4% on the previous year and down 5.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, greenhouse gas emissions by sector in Japan peaked at 31.33 million tonnes in 1994 and was at its lowest, 22.77 million tonnes, in 2023.
That places Japan 58th out of 193 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 34 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 29.59 million tonnes | 27.19 million tonnes | 31.33 million tonnes | 10 |
| 2000s | 25.88 million tonnes | 24.71 million tonnes | 26.98 million tonnes | 10 |
| 2010s | 23.69 million tonnes | 23.01 million tonnes | 25.01 million tonnes | 10 |
| 2020s | 22.95 million tonnes | 22.77 million tonnes | 23.09 million tonnes | 4 |
